I have been using an iPhone 6 for the last year or so, with the Touch ID feature enabled and functioning as expected. Yesterday and today I noticed that the Touch ID feature was non-functional.
I have reset Accessibility settings related to the Home button. I've backed up the phone and erased everything (all steps to resolve that I found on various on-line blogs), and setup the phone as a new phone. Still, I get an error message : Failed Unable to complete Touch ID setup. Please go back and try again.
iOS 11.4.1 is the updated OS version.
It's frustrating to have access to this feature (which I actually enjoyed over having to key in a passcode) and then it's just gone with no apparent ability to restore it. Anyone encountered this?
